npm 包 gemstone-config-webpack 使用教程

阅读时长 5 分钟读完

本教程将介绍如何使用 gemstone-config-webpack 这个 npm 包,它提供了一个方便且易于使用的 UI 组件库来帮助前端开发者在使用 webpack 时更加轻松地管理配置。

什么是 gemstone-config-webpack

gemstone-config-webpack 是一个基于 webpack 的配置库,通过可视化的方式帮助开发者简化 webpack 的配置流程和管理方式。它提供了一个 UI 界面让开发者可以方便地配置 webpack 的各项参数,同时支持自定义配置和导出配置文件,可适用于任何 webpack 项目的需要。

安装

在使用 gemstone-config-webpack 之前,你需要先确保你的电脑上已经安装了 Node.js 和 npm。安装完成后,你可以在你的项目中运行以下命令来安装 gemstone-config-webpack

使用教程

使用 gemstone-config-webpack 可以将 webpack 的配置转化为可视化界面,方便大家进行管理。本教程将演示如何通过 gemstone-config-webpack 完成一个基本的项目配置。

Step1:引入 gemstone-config-webpack

在 webpack 的配置文件中引入 gemstone-config-webpack

Step2:配置 webpack

将 webpack 的配置放在一个 json 对象中:

-- -------------------- ---- -------
----- ------------- - -
  ------ ---------------
  ------- -
    --------- ------------
    ----- ----------------------- -------
  --
  ------- -
    ------ -
      -
        ----- --------
        -------- ---------------
        ---- -
          ------- ---------------
          -------- -
            -------- ---------------------
          -
        -
      -
    -
  -
--

-------------- - --------------

Step3:使用 gemstone-config-webpack 定制配置

使用 ConfigWebpackPlugin 创建一个配置实例,并在 webpackConfigplugins 属性中将其添加:

-- -------------------- ---- -------
----- ------------- - -
  -----
  -------- -
    --- ---------------------
      -------- -------------------- ------------------
      -- ---------
      ----------- -------------------- -----------------------
    ---
    -----
  -
-

Step 4:自定义配置参数

config/gemstone.js 中加入需要自定义的配置参数:

-- -------------------- ---- -------
----- - ------- ----------- -------- ---- - - ---------------------------

----- --- - -
  ----- - ------ --------- ----- ------------- -
--

----- ----------- - -
  ---------- -
    ----- -------------
    ---------- ------------------------
    ------ ----------
    ------- -----------------------
  --
  --------- -
    ----- --------------------
    ---------- -----------------------
    ------ ------------
    ------- ----------------------
  -
--

----- -------- - -
  ----- -
    ------ -------
    ------------
    ---------- ---
    ----
    ------------------- -----------
    -------------- ---------------
    ------------------- --------------------
    -- -- ---- --
    ----- ----
  --
  ---- ---
  ----- ---
  ---- ---
  ----- --
--

-------------- - -
  ----- -----------
  -------- ----------------------------
  ---------
  ---- ---
  ------- ---
  ------ ---
  ---- ---
  --------- ---
  ------- ---
  ----------- --
--

Step5:打包运行

运行 npm run dev 命令即可打包运行项目。如果需要导出 webpack 配置文件,则运行 npm run exportConfig 命令即可。

结语

通过 gemstone-config-webpack,我们可以轻松地利用可视化方式管理 webpack 的诸多参数,使 webpack 配置变得更加方便和容易调整,同时也提高了开发效率,推动了项目的进展。希望本教程对大家学习 gemstone-config-webpack 有所帮助。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/66306

纠错
反馈